Is Tom Jones black Singer plans DNA test

After being told that he is “just passing as white”, Welsh crooner Tom Jones says he is ready to take a DNA test to find out once and for all if he has black ancestry.

The star, whose hits include It’s Not Unusual, Delilah and Sex Bomb, is often thought to have black heritage for his booming baritone voice, tight curly hair and olive complexion.

“A lot of people still think I’m black. When I first came to America, people who had heard me sing on the radio would be surprised that I was white when they saw me,” Jones was quoted as saying by the Times. “When I was born, my mother came out in big dark patches all over her body. They asked if she had any black blood and she said she didn’t know. I’m going to get my DNA tested. I want to find out,” he said. DNA tests claiming to track ancestral lineage are now easily accessible and affordable.
